                  #23
                  Originally posted by Evo_Lee
                  MIVEC for it's purpose was introduced for a better response, wider power band and better fuel efficency.

                  The motor journos in Japan have mixed feelings about MIVEC...though overall the E9 is still good. Because the most important thing, the superior handling is still there for the driver to keep pushing the car to the limit.
                  Exactly. Evos have always been about response and the widest possible power band. I doubt you would see much difference in outright power, but possibly a change for better/earlier power delivery. IMHO the top end on evos has never been that strong due to the mid range bias. The fitting of MIVEC could be to counter the use of a smaller turbo for better response with higher lift cams.
